What is The Haven on Norwegian Cruise Line?

Pioneering the ship-within-ship concept, Norwegian Cruise Line (NCL) was the first to introduce the feature of an exclusive all-suite quarter with a private sun deck and pool facilities. 

The concept evolved into The Haven, where guests can now enjoy the opulence of first-class accommodation, exclusive dining and other luxury benefits accessed via their Haven-specific platinum keycard while still enjoying the wide-ranging facilities and entertainment on an NCL ship. Although the Haven is not an adults-only facility, there are areas, such as the Haven Sundeck, which are reserved for guests of 16 years and over. 

Which Norwegian ship has the best Haven?

ncl bliss

The Haven by Norwegian Cruise Line can be found on the following ships: 

Norwegian Prima, Norwegian Viva, Norwegian Bliss, Norwegian Escape, Norwegian Encore, Norwegian Joy, Norwegian Getaway, Norwegian Breakaway, Norwegian Epic, Norwegian Gem, Norwegian Jade, Norwegian Jewel, and Norwegian Pearl.

If you are seeking the Norwegian ship with the best Haven, its Prima-class ships, Norwegian Prima and Norwegian Viva, arguably are where you’ll find it. As NCL’s newest ships, they have the most innovative features, including an infinity pool located in the prime position at the rear of the vessel and a larger restaurant, perfect for special events. 

The Prima-class ships have also been designed to offer more space per cruise guest and higher crew-to-guest ratios. Furthermore, many cruise guests enjoy having all the Haven suites together when sailing on Norwegian Prima and Norwegian Viva, adding to that ship-within-a-ship feel. 

What is included in a Haven suite?

Suites within Norwegian Cruise Line’s The Haven are designed to offer you the utmost luxury, more space and outstanding amenities. There are nine options of stateroom to choose from, ranging from the Spa Suite with Balcony (378 sq. ft.) that sleeps two guests up to the 3-Bedroom Garden Villa (6,694 sq. ft.) that can accommodate eight.

In your suite, a 24-hour, fully-trained butler will await to unpack your suitcases, pour champagne, and serve your meal, if you opt for white tablecloth in-suite dining. You’ll also have access to an in-suite minibar and a deluxe coffee machine. 

All suites have a contemporary design, many with a king-sized bed, large living and dining areas or a separate room for the children, one or more baths and a balcony. Other plans have been designed to have a cosy feel, such as the Spa Suite, which is still beautifully decorated and comes with its own hot tub, waterfall shower and multiple body spray jets.

You may want to savour every moment on board, but sleeping can be irresistible in your Haven suite with a Bliss Collection pillow-top mattress, feather duvet and pillow menu. Relaxing in-suite is also a joy with plush bathrobes, slippers and luxury bathroom products.

Delightful dining at The Haven by Norwegian Cruise Line

As a guest at The Haven, you’ll not only get reservation priority at the ship’s restaurants (including their speciality dining), but you’ll also have exclusive access to the Haven Restaurant. Here you can expect a variety of high-quality, delicious dishes for breakfast, lunch and dinner that are unique to The Haven.

Service is first-rate, enabling you to sit back and enjoy the relaxed yet stylish ambience. 

Another enjoy-it-all perk of Norwegian Cruise Line’s The Haven is complimentary meals at the speciality dining restaurants on board. Options include the signature seafood restaurant Bayamo, NCL’s iconic steakhouse Cagney’s or classic Italian dishes at La Cucina.

Are drinks free in The Haven on NCL?

Guests staying at The Haven have the Premium Beverages package included as part of their cruise fare. With this package, you can enjoy unlimited beers, wines and spirits, cocktails, soft drinks and bottled water. 

Relaxation at The Haven

The Haven has been designed to offer guests the space to unwind and relax, whether sitting back in the hot tub bubbles on its exclusive sundeck, soaking up the rays on a lounge daybed at the Courtyard pool area or enjoying a good book with your morning coffee in The Haven Lounge.

When it comes to well-being facilities, the Haven has its own private sauna. If you are a Haven Spa Suite guest, you can also enjoy complimentary access to the Mandara Spa and Thermal Spa Suites on certain ships. With over 50 speciality treatments offered here, including soothing facials, massages and acupuncture, you’ll be left feeling fully recharged and rejuvenated.

What else is included in NCL The Haven? 

As a guest at Norwegian Cruise Line’s The Haven, there are many more little indulgent benefits that you can enjoy throughout your cruise holiday. So, what else does The Haven get you on NCL? 

Here’s a summary of a few more of the luxuries you can experience:

Priority boarding and escort at embarkation and tender ports

Concierge service to assist with reservations for things such as dining, entertainment, shore excursions

Attentive on-deck service for towels and refreshments

Exclusive cocktail parties

A mobile phone for use on the ship (specific to Norwegian Escape, Norwegian Getaway, Norwegian Breakaway and Norwegian Epic)

Sparkling wine, bottled water and fruit on embarkation day (2-Bedroom villa, Courtyard Penthouse, Spa Suite, and Penthouse only)

Shore excursion discount

What is the dress code at Norwegian Cruise Line’s The Haven?

At Norwegian Cruise Line, The Haven, the dress code is smart casual in its restaurants. Trousers or jeans, collared shirts and closed shoes are fine for men, while ladies can also choose to wear dresses or skirts and tops. 

During the day, the dress code is known as cruise casual. For restaurants inside, this means that shorts and casual shirts are acceptable. When heading to the buffet or outdoor restaurants, a shirt or cover-up over your swimwear is also okay. 

How much is The Haven suite on NCL?

Although prices will vary depending on the type of Haven suite you choose, your dates and your itinerary, on average, Haven suites cost around 70% more than a standard Balcony cabin, which can mean up to an additional $1,000 per person, per day for the experience.

With more space, more personalised service, and all the extra luxuries included in the Norwegian Cruise Line’s The Haven’s cost, many cruise guests find it worth the additional spend.
